O & M Program Sample Clauses
The O & M Program clause defines the requirements and procedures for the ongoing operation and maintenance of a facility, system, or equipment. It typically outlines the responsibilities of the parties involved, specifies the standards or schedules for maintenance activities, and may require the creation and submission of detailed maintenance plans or records. By establishing clear expectations for upkeep and performance, this clause helps ensure the long-term reliability and efficiency of the asset, while minimizing the risk of breakdowns or costly repairs.
O & M Program. In the event any environmental report delivered to Lender in connection with the Loan recommends the development of or continued compliance with an operation and maintenance program for the Property (including, without limitation, with respect to the presence of asbestos and/or lead-based paint) (“O & M Program”), Borrower shall develop (or continue to comply with, as the case may be) such O & M Program and shall, during the term of the Loan, including any extension or renewal thereof, comply in all material respects with the terms and conditions of the O & M Program.
